
jQuery 1.3 HTML版帮助文档:简化JavaScript编程

jQuery 是一个快速、小巧且功能丰富的 JavaScript 库,其核心理念是“写得更少,做得更多”(Write Less, Do More)。标题中提到的“jQuery帮助文档(HTML版)”指的是一份以 HTML 格式组织的、用于指导开发者学习和使用 jQuery 的官方或第三方技术文档。这类文档通常包含完整的 API 参考、方法说明、事件处理机制、选择器语法、DOM 操作、动画效果、Ajax 请求支持以及插件扩展等内容,适用于前端开发人员在实际项目中查阅与学习。该文档以本地 HTML 文件的形式存在,意味着用户无需联网即可访问全部内容,极大提升了开发过程中的效率和便捷性。
从描述“可以简化JavaScript的编码工作。而且简单易学。”可以看出,jQuery 最大的优势在于它极大地降低了原生 JavaScript 编程的复杂度。例如,在没有 jQuery 的时代,要为页面上的多个元素绑定点击事件,开发者需要手动遍历 DOM 节点,并兼容不同浏览器之间的差异(如 IE 与其他现代浏览器在事件模型上的不一致),而 jQuery 提供了统一的 `.on('click', handler)` 方法,不仅语法简洁,还自动处理了跨浏览器兼容问题。此外,jQuery 封装了大量常用功能,比如 DOM 元素的选择与操作、CSS 样式控制、属性设置、类名增删、节点插入删除等,只需一行代码即可完成原本需要数行甚至十几行原生 JS 才能实现的功能。
标签“jquery”进一步强调了这份资源的核心主题——即围绕 jQuery 框架展开的技术内容。作为曾经最流行的前端库之一,jQuery 在 2006 年由 John Resig 发布后迅速风靡全球,几乎成为每一个 Web 开发者的必备工具。尽管近年来随着 React、Vue 等现代框架的兴起,jQuery 的使用率有所下降,但在维护旧系统、快速原型开发、小型项目或对性能要求不高的场景中,它依然具有不可替代的价值。
压缩包内文件名为“jquery1.3”,表明这是 jQuery 1.3 版本的相关文件。这个版本发布于 2009 年初,属于早期较为成熟的稳定版本之一。jQuery 1.3 引入了许多重要特性,显著增强了库的功能性和执行效率。其中最具代表性的更新包括:Sizzle 引擎的引入,这是一个独立的 CSS 选择器引擎,使得 jQuery 的选择器查找速度大幅提升;新增 `live()` 方法(后来被 `on()` 取代),允许动态绑定事件到当前及未来将要添加的元素上;改进了事件系统,使事件委托更加高效;增强对动画的支持,提供了更流畅的视觉效果;同时优化了 DOM 遍历与操作的方法链设计,让代码更具可读性。
具体来说,jQuery 1.3 中的选择器能力得到了极大的扩展,除了基本的标签、ID、类选择器外,还支持复杂的层级关系、属性过滤、位置伪类(如 `:first`, `:last`, `:even`, `:odd`)等高级筛选方式,这使得开发者能够像使用 CSS 一样精准地定位页面元素。例如,`$('div.myClass:hidden')` 可以一次性选出所有隐藏状态下的具有 myClass 类的 div 元素,这种表达式的直观性和强大功能正是 jQuery 吸引众多开发者的原因之一。
在 DOM 操作方面,jQuery 提供了一整套连贯的接口,如 `append()`, `prepend()`, `before()`, `after()`, `remove()`, `empty()` 等,配合链式调用语法,可以让代码结构清晰、逻辑紧凑。例如:
```javascript
$('#container')
.append('<p>新段落</p>')
.find('p')
.css('color', 'red')
.fadeOut(1000);
```
上述代码展示了如何在一个语句中完成元素追加、子元素查找、样式修改和动画隐藏的操作,充分体现了 jQuery “链式编程”的优雅之处。
此外,jQuery 还封装了 Ajax 功能,使得异步请求变得极为简单。通过 `$.ajax()`, `$.get()`, `$.post()` 等方法,开发者可以用极少的代码实现数据交互。例如:
```javascript
$.get('/api/data', function(response) {
$('#result').html(response);
});
```
这段代码就能发起 GET 请求并把返回结果填充到指定元素中,省去了创建 XMLHttpRequest 对象、监听状态变化、处理回调等一系列繁琐步骤。
综上所述,“jquery帮助文档(HTML版)”结合其描述与文件名信息,实质上提供了一个面向 jQuery 1.3 版本的完整知识体系,涵盖了从基础语法到高级应用的各个方面。对于初学者而言,它是入门 JavaScript 前端开发的理想教材;对于有经验的开发者,则是一个可靠的参考手册。即使在今天,理解 jQuery 的设计理念和使用模式,仍然有助于深入掌握 Web 开发的本质原理,尤其是在分析遗留系统或进行轻量级交互开发时,具备重要的实践意义。
相关推荐


















lzw1022
- 粉丝: 4
最新资源
- 基于VC6.0编译的FFmpeg output_example入门程序
- 超完整数据结构1800题含答案解析
- 基于.NET实现任意网页源码获取功能
- Microsoft SQL Server 2005 JDBC驱动jar包下载
- 基于VC的简易网络聊天室实现源码
- JSP中文手册与入门帮助文档合集
- 基于Seam2.0的全国省份城市二级级联实现
- Driverstudio示例程序包分享:WMISample、USBCounter与TimerSample
- 基于多层CSS实现的许愿墙卡片特效
- 58个国外流行的CSS菜单素材免费下载
- H3C ICG2000 1710版本SNMP配置详解
- 基于Delphi的物业水电表抄表管理软件
- 基于C#开发的正则表达式检验工具
- 掌握801路由配置,快速提升网络技能
- VLAN从进阶到精通:全面掌握虚拟局域网技术
- C#实现UDP消息发送与接收的简易Demo
- MSN安全防护模块:防范泄密与病毒风险
- 马文蔚物理学课后习题完整答案下载
- SQL Server 2000 JDBC驱动包详解
- 基于CSS+DIV实现的滑动选项卡效果
- 2008南开二级C语言上机300题完整答案解析
- WebMail最新版邮件系统压缩包
- 华为编码规范与编程范例学习文档
- VB6.0动态获取运行中程序与控件名称及内容